Alaska's extreme cold and extended winters place significant demands on heating appliances. Chimneys in Anchorage and surrounding areas are used for months on end, leading to substantial creosote buildup and potential structural stress from temperature fluctuations. The state's building codes do not specifically mandate chimney sweep licensing, but working with experienced, insured professionals is vital. They understand how to service chimneys in harsh conditions and identify potential issues before they become serious problems.

What should I do before a chimney sweep arrives in Alaska?

Ensure the area around your fireplace is clear of clutter and flammable materials. Move any furniture or decorations away from the hearth. This allows our technicians to work safely and efficiently. We will lay down protective drop cloths.

How often does my chimney need cleaning in Anchorage?

Given the extensive use of fireplaces and wood stoves during Alaska's long winters, we recommend an annual cleaning. This frequency helps prevent dangerous creosote fires and ensures optimal performance of your heating system. Regular service is essential for safety.

Do I need a permit for chimney cleaning in Alaska?

Routine chimney cleaning generally does not require a permit in Alaska. However, if any structural repairs or modifications are identified, local building departments may require permits. We can advise you on any such specific requirements.

What is involved in an emergency chimney sweep in Alaska?

An emergency sweep addresses immediate safety concerns such as a chimney fire or a sudden, severe blockage. Our technicians will quickly assess the situation and perform the necessary cleaning and safety checks. We prioritize swift action to mitigate risks.

How do I prepare for an emergency chimney sweep?

If you suspect a chimney fire, evacuate your home and call 911 immediately. For other urgent issues, ensure access to the fireplace and chimney exterior is clear. Provide our technician with any relevant details about the problem.
